Biography
Early Life
Cristiano Ronaldo dos Santos Aveiro was born on February 5, 1985, on the island of Madeira, Portugal. He grew up in poverty in a cramped house with his three siblings. His father worked as a kit man at a local club, and from an early age it was clear the youngest child had something extraordinary.
Breakthrough
Ronaldo moved from Sporting CP to Manchester United in 2003 for £12.24 million aged just 18, after a pre-season friendly in which he tormented United's defenders so badly that they begged Sir Alex Ferguson to sign him. He spent six electric years at Old Trafford before Real Madrid came calling.
Career
At Real Madrid, Ronaldo became a machine. Four Champions League titles. Four Ballon d'Ors with Los Blancos. A record 450 goals in 438 appearances. He then moved to Juventus and later returned to Manchester United before a controversial exit took him to Al Nassr in Saudi Arabia — where he continued breaking records at an age when most players had retired.
Personal Life
Off the pitch, Ronaldo is inseparable from his children — four in total, with his partner Georgina Rodriguez. He is obsessive about his fitness regime, reportedly sleeping five 90-minute sleep sessions per day, and follows an extremely strict diet. He doesn't drink alcohol and famously removed Coca-Cola bottles from a press conference to the company's dismay.

Career Timeline
Made his professional debut for Sporting CP aged 17
Signed by Sir Alex Ferguson for £12.24M after mesmerising United in a pre-season friendly
Joined Real Madrid for a then world record £80M fee, becoming their all-time top scorer
Moved to Juventus for £88M aged 33, shocking the football world
Returned to Old Trafford on a dramatic deadline day in a move that felt like a blockbuster
Became the highest-paid player on the planet after joining Al Nassr in Saudi Arabia
Fun Facts
Ronaldo is the most followed person on Instagram with over 645 million followers
He has scored over 900 career goals across club and country
Ronaldo holds the record for most international goals ever scored — 136 for Portugal
He has won five Ballon d'Or awards spread across different clubs
Ronaldo's net worth makes him one of the first footballer billionaires in history
